Maryland State Retirement & Pension System's Q3 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2025, Maryland State Retirement & Pension System held 1,510 positions worth $4.76B, up 4.3% from $4.57B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 26% of the portfolio.

Maryland State Retirement & Pension System's Q3 2025 filing shows 22 new, 523 increased, 453 reduced and 142 closed positions. Its largest new stake was iShares Core S&P Small-Cap ETF: 7,821 shares worth $929K. The largest sale was iShares MSCI EAFE ETF, an estimated $6.04M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 23% of assets, up from 21% a quarter earlier, followed by Energy and Financials.
